7th vs 8th Pay Commission DA Comparison Table: A pay commission is an occasion for lakhs of central government employees when their salary is revised. It may give a notable jump to their monthly payouts, helping them maintain their lifestyle, achieve financial goals, and boost their retirement benefits.
While a pay commission is formed once in a decade and there is no change in the basic pay of employees for the next 10 years, their overall payout keeps increasing thanks to dearness allowance (DA) revision.
DA is revised twice a year, helping employees beat inflation.
The DA increase is done as a percentage of the employee’s basic pay.
If the basic salary in a pay commission rises, the DA amount automatically rises.

How DA works for employees
DA is calculated on the basis of basic salary. So, if your basic pay is Rs 30,000 and the DA rate is 50 per cent, you will get Rs 15,000 in the form of DA. If DA increases to 55 per cent, the DA amount will rise to Rs 16,500 from Rs 15,000. Here’s how salary will look-
When DA was 50 per cent- Rs 30,000+Rs 15,000= Rs 45,000
When DA is 55 per cent- Rs 30,000+Rs 16,500= Rs 46,500
Fitment factor for 8th Pay Commission
The fitment factor will be known once the 8th Pay Commission recommendations are implemented. Many projections and experts suggest that it can be in the range of 1.92-2.86.
